Nota di contenuto: | Heat Flux Measurement and Heat Flux Sensors -- Gradient Heat Flux Sensors -- Transient Heat Flux Measurement -- Multifunctional Performance of Gradient Heat Flux Sensors -- Testing of Gradient Heat Flux Sensors -- Gradient Heat Flux Measurement on Technical Objects. |
Sommario/riassunto: | This book is a translation from a Russian book. In 2007, the authors created a new generation of layered composite-based sensors, whose advantages are high technology and thermal stability. The use of gradient heat flux sensors in laboratory and industrial conditions confirmed their reliability, showed high information, and allowed a number of priority results to be obtained. All of this is summarized in this book. |
